Apstrakt

Proponents of application of so called audit culture criteria onto activities of Serbian academic community are guided by the principle that not only is everything subject to measuring, but that it is the only way to determine the "objective" results of a particular institution or individual. However, because of the absence of an exact method for such "measuring", they refer to standards and parameters which they either proclaim themselves, or adopt from foreign institutions, often tailoring them to suit their own political purposes in the process of alleged "imposing order" in scientific and professional activity of the academic community. Members of the academic community and their particular work are left unconsidered by those scientific and educational "reformists", or at least invisible in respective regulations. Bearing in mind that current legal regulations in the area of higher education state that external evaluation is preceded by process of self-evaluation of a particular institution, I propose methodology for identification of the real work-load of University professors, with regard to their obligations stemming from the employment contract, Law on University, and Statute of the Faculty. All this is based on personal records of duties and on the calculation of time that was needed to fulfill those duties in a professional and quality manner during one academic year.
